他のバージョンの文書10 | 9.6 | 9.5 | 9.4 | 9.3 | 9.2 | 9.1 | 9.0 | 8.4 | 8.3 | 8.2 | 8.1 | 8.0 | 7.4 | 7.3 | 7.2

第 33章ECPG - C言語による埋め込みSQL

目次
33.1. 概念
33.2. データベースサーバへの接続
33.3. 接続を閉じる
33.4. SQLコマンドの実行
33.5. 接続の選択
33.6. ホスト変数の使用
33.6.1. 概要
33.6.2. 宣言セクション
33.6.3. 様々なホスト変数の型
33.6.4. SELECT INTOFETCH INTO
33.6.5. 指示子
33.7. 動的SQL
33.8. pgtypesライブラリ
33.8.1. 数値型
33.8.2. 日付型
33.8.3. タイムスタンプ型
33.8.4. 時間間隔型
33.8.5. 10進数型
33.8.6. pgtypeslibのerrno値
33.8.7. pgtypeslibの特殊な定数
33.9. 記述子領域の使用
33.9.1. 名前付きSQL記述子領域
33.9.2. SQLDA記述子領域
33.10. Informix互換モード
33.10.1. 追加の型
33.10.2. 追加または存在しない埋め込みSQL文
33.10.3. Informix-compatible SQLDA Descriptor Areas
33.10.4. 追加関数
33.10.5. 追加の定数
33.11. エラーの扱い
33.11.1. コールバックの設定
33.11.2. sqlca
33.11.3. SQLSTATESQLCODE
33.12. プリプロセッサ指示子
33.12.1. ファイルのインクルード
33.12.2. #defineおよび#undef指示子
33.12.3. ifdef、ifndef、else、elif、endif指示子
33.13. 埋め込みSQLプログラムの処理
33.14. ライブラリ関数
33.15. 内部

本章では、PostgreSQLの埋め込みSQLパッケージについて説明します。 このパッケージはCC++言語で作成されました。 作者はLinus Tolke()とMichael Meskes()です。 元々これはCで動作するように作成されました。 C++でも動作しますが、C++の構文すべてはまだ認識できません。

本書は完全なものではありません。 しかし、このインタフェースは標準化されているので、SQLに関するその他の資料から追加情報を入手できます。